question text To ask the Chancellor of the Exchequer, what steps he is taking to reduce VAT on community defibrillators and the cabinets in which they are housed to match the VAT free status of the pads and batteries. more like this

answer text The Government already maintains VAT reliefs to aid the purchase of Automated External Defibrillators (AEDs), including VAT relief on purchases made by local authorities and those made through voluntary contributions, where the AED is donated to eligible charities or the NHS. Otherwise, they attract the standard rate of VAT.<p> </p><p>Any new VAT relief would come at a cost to the Exchequer and the Government has received over £50 billion worth of requests for relief from VAT since the EU referendum.</p><p> </p><p>The Government however keeps all taxes under constant review.</p> more like this

question text To ask the Secretary of State for Digital, Culture, Media and Sport, pursuant to the Answer of on 8 November 2021 to Question 71330 on Ofcom: Recruitment, how many staff on a FTE basis Ofcom has employed to support its duties under the Telecoms Security Bill as at 6 April 2021. more like this

answer text <p>The Ofcom security budget for this financial year has been increased by £4.6 million. This funding will allow Ofcom to more than double the number of staff working on telecoms security by April 2022 by hiring around 30 FTE. This includes hiring a multi-skilled team including technical, enforcement and legal experts.</p> more like this
